Business Crew- Fashion (Retail Store)

<strong>About Broadway<br><br></strong>Broadway is India's modern department store, bringing together the best digital-first, emerging, and established brands across Beauty & Personal Care, Health & Wellness, Fashion & Lifestyle, Footwear & Accessories, Home, and more. We are creating a retail experience where discovery, education, and exceptional customer service come together.<br><br><strong>Role Overview<br><br></strong>As the <strong>Business Crew – Fashion</strong>, you will lead the day-to-day operations of the Fashion department, ensuring an exceptional customer experience while driving sales, team performance, and operational excellence.<br><br><strong>Key Responsibilities<br><br></strong><strong>Business & Sales<br><br></strong><ul><li>Drive daily, weekly, and monthly sales targets for the Fashion department.</li><li>Improve conversion, average bill value (ABV), units per bill (UPT), and repeat customer engagement.</li><li>Deliver personalized product recommendations based on customer needs, preferences, and style.</li><li>Identify opportunities to maximize category performance through upselling and cross-selling.<br><br></li></ul><strong>Customer Experience<br><br></strong><ul><li>Deliver a premium, personalized, and consultative shopping experience.</li><li>Understand customer preferences and provide relevant styling and product recommendations.</li><li>Resolve customer concerns professionally and efficiently.</li><li>Build long-term customer relationships through trust, product knowledge, and personalized service.</li><li>Support fashion events, launches, styling activities, and in-store brand activations.<br><br></li></ul><strong>Operations & Inventory<br><br></strong><ul><li>Ensure merchandise is fully stocked, well-presented, and compliant with Broadway merchandising standards.</li><li>Monitor stock availability, replenishment, size availability, and inventory accuracy.</li><li>Coordinate with the inventory and operations teams to minimize stock loss and shrinkage.</li><li>Maintain high standards of store hygiene, organization, and product handling.<br><br></li></ul><strong>Brand & Merchandising<br><br></strong><ul><li>Execute visual merchandising guidelines for the Fashion category.</li><li>Ensure products are displayed as per brand and Broadway standards.</li><li>Support new collection launches, promotional campaigns, seasonal displays, and brand activations.</li><li>Partner with brand representatives to improve customer engagement, product knowledge, and category performance.<br><br></li></ul><strong>Reporting & Compliance<br><br></strong><ul><li>Track departmental KPIs and share performance updates with the Department Manager.</li><li>Ensure compliance with company policies, SOPs, billing processes, and audit requirements.</li><li>Maintain accurate records related to inventory, damages, customer feedback, and other departmental activities.<br><br></li></ul><strong>Skills & Competencies<br><br></strong><ul><li>Strong leadership and team management skills.</li><li>Excellent communication and interpersonal abilities.</li><li>Customer-first mindset with consultative selling and styling skills.</li><li>Strong understanding of fashion retail operations and inventory management.</li><li>Good understanding of fashion trends, products, and customer preferences.</li><li>Ability to work in a fast-paced retail environment.</li><li>Problem-solving and decision-making capability.</li><li>High ownership and execution orientation.<br><br></li></ul><strong>Preferred Experience<br><br></strong><ul><li>2–5 years of experience in retail, preferably in Fashion, Lifestyle, Apparel, Accessories, or Modern Trade.</li><li>Prior experience leading a retail team is preferred.</li><li>Strong knowledge of fashion products, styling, trends, and customer preferences is an advantage.<br><br></li></ul><strong>Educational Qualification<br><br></strong><ul><li>Graduate in any discipline.</li><li>Certification or educational background in Fashion, Styling, Merchandising, or related fields will be an added advantage.<br><br></li></ul><strong>What Success Looks Like<br><br></strong><ul><li>Consistently achieves sales and productivity targets.</li><li>Builds a knowledgeable, high-performing team.</li><li>Delivers exceptional customer satisfaction and repeat business.</li><li>Maintains high standards of merchandising, inventory accuracy, and compliance.</li><li>Creates a culture of ownership, learning, and customer obsession on the shop floor.</li></ul>
